How much does a 30 second radio ad cost?
The average radio ad is 30 seconds long, but it’s possible to buy 15 second ads, 60 second ads or even 90 second ads. For smaller markets, you can expect to spend about $900 a week for a typical 30 second ad schedule and $8,000 a week in larger markets such as Sydney and Melbourne.
How much does it cost to put an ad on TikTok?
$10 per CPM
TikTok ads start at $10 per CPM. Reports from AdAge in late 2019 show that TikTok’s cost of advertising can be between $50,000 to $120,000 depending on the ad format and duration.
How much is twitter ads cost?
While promoted tweets cost $0.50 to $2 per action, like a retweet, follow or like, promoted accounts cost $2 to $4 per follow….How much does Twitter advertising cost?
TWITTER AD | TWITTER AD COST |
---|---|
Promoted tweet | $0.50-$2.00 per action |
Promoted account | $2-$4 per follow |
Promoted trend | $200,000 per day |
What is the average cost of radio advertising?
Radio advertising production includes scriptwriting, voice talent, and audio/video editing. Radio advertisements are sometimes produced with videos because of social media sharing, which is incredibly strategic. The production costs range between $300 to $2,000, plus the weekly airtime costs that vary between $200 to $6,000 depending on location.
How much does it cost to advertise on the radio?
While station and market affect the cost, radio advertising often falls between $200 and $5,000 per week. Cost will be affected by length of advertisement, time, location, and station. For instance, a 60-second ad will cost more than a 30-second ad and an ad played late at night will cost less than an ad aired during rush hour.
